Modern endpoint protection goes beyond traditional antivirus by combining detection, analysis, and response into one system.
Identifies suspicious activity based on behaviour rather than relying on known threat signatures.
Continuously monitors devices to detect threats, investigate incidents, and enable rapid response.
Automatically isolates compromised devices to prevent threats spreading across your network.
Provides ongoing visibility into device activity, helping detect risks early.
Allows deeper analysis of threats, helping understand how incidents occurred and how to prevent them.
Gives a single view of all endpoints, alerts, and actions for easier management.
Enables faster action through automated threat containment and response workflows.
